可以,现代智能手机已具备完整的开发环境,通过特定应用或云端服务,完全能够独立编写、编译并测试移动端应用程序。

在2026年的技术语境下,手机开发App已不再是极客的专属玩具,而是基于轻量化IDE(集成开发环境)和云端算力协同的成熟工作流,这一转变得益于移动芯片算力的指数级增长以及低代码/无代码平台的普及,使得“口袋里的开发工作室”成为可能。
手机端开发App的技术可行性与核心优势
手机开发并非传统意义上的原生编译,而是依托于虚拟化环境和云端构建能力,对于初学者或需要快速验证想法的开发者而言,这种模式具有显著优势。
随时随地的高效响应
传统开发依赖高性能PC,而手机开发打破了空间限制。
* **碎片化时间利用**:利用通勤或会议间隙,通过手机IDE进行逻辑梳理或代码片段编写。
* **即时预览**:结合蓝牙连接或局域网传输,可实时在真机上查看UI渲染效果,大幅缩短“修改-编译-运行”的反馈周期。
降低硬件门槛与成本
* **算力卸载**:现代手机开发App通常将重型编译任务卸载至云端服务器,本地仅负责代码编辑与轻量级调试。
* **设备通用性**:无需购买昂贵的MacBook或高性能工作站,千元级安卓旗舰或最新款iPhone即可满足基础开发需求。
主流开发工具对比分析
| 工具类型 | 代表应用 | 适用平台 | 核心特点 | 适合人群 |
|---|---|---|---|---|
| 云端IDE | GitHub Codespaces, Replit | 全平台 | 浏览器/APP内运行完整Linux环境,支持Docker | 全栈开发者,需复杂依赖 |
| 原生编辑器 | AIDE, Termux | Android | 本地编译Java/Kotlin,无需联网 | 安卓底层爱好者,离线开发 |
| 跨平台框架 | FlutterFlow, Expo Go | iOS/Android | 可视化拖拽+代码混合,一键生成 | UI设计师,快速原型验证 |
2026年手机端开发App的实战场景与限制
尽管技术已成熟,但手机开发并非万能,明确其适用边界,是避免资源浪费的关键。

最佳应用场景
* **MVP(最小可行性产品)验证**:创业者可在手机端快速搭建Demo,用于向投资人展示核心逻辑,验证市场反应。
* **脚本与自动化开发**:使用Python或JavaScript编写自动化脚本、爬虫工具或简单的API接口服务。
* **学习编程基础**:对于零基础用户,通过手机学习Python、Swift等语法,比安装复杂IDE更友好,降低了入门心理门槛。
核心局限性
* **输入效率瓶颈**:尽管有外接键盘辅助,但手机屏幕的触控输入在编写长篇代码时,效率仍远低于物理键盘+鼠标组合。
* **调试复杂度受限**:涉及底层硬件交互(如蓝牙低功耗、传感器深度数据)或大型项目依赖管理时,手机端的调试工具链往往不够完善。
* **性能瓶颈**:虽然云端编译解决了算力问题,但本地预览大型3D应用或复杂动画时,仍可能出现卡顿,影响体验判断。
如何开始?2026年最新入门指南
若你决定尝试手机开发,建议遵循以下路径,确保学习曲线平滑。
选择正确的工具链
* **iOS用户**:推荐下载**Swift Playgrounds**,这是苹果官方推出的教育级开发工具,支持从图形化积木到完整Swift代码的过渡,且能直接发布App到App Store。
* **Android用户**:推荐使用**AIDE**或**Termux**,前者提供图形化界面,后者提供类Linux终端体验,适合喜欢命令行操作的进阶用户。
* **跨平台需求**:若希望同时覆盖iOS和Android,建议使用**FlutterFlow**等低代码平台,通过手机浏览器或APP进行可视化构建,后期再导出代码进行微调。
掌握核心开发技能
* **前端基础**:优先掌握HTML/CSS/JavaScript或Flutter/Dart框架,这些语言在手机端IDE中支持度最高。
* **版本控制**:务必注册GitHub账号,学会使用Git进行代码版本管理,手机端虽不便,但通过SSH连接GitHub是专业开发的必经之路。
* **API对接**:学习如何使用Postman或类似工具调试RESTful API,这是现代App与后端交互的核心。
避坑建议
* **不要试图在手机端开发大型原生App**:如大型游戏或复杂企业级应用,请回归PC端。
* **注意电量与发热**:云端编译虽不消耗本地算力,但屏幕常亮和网络传输仍会显著增加耗电,建议连接电源操作。
* **警惕隐私风险**:避免在公共Wi-Fi下处理敏感代码,建议使用手机热点或加密网络。
常见疑问解答
Q1: 手机开发的App能直接上架应用商店吗?
A: 可以,通过Swift Playgrounds开发的iOS应用可直接提交至App Store审核;Android应用通过AIDE或云端构建生成的APK/AAB文件,也可上传至Google Play或国内各大安卓市场,关键在于最终构建产物需符合平台规范。
Q2: 手机端开发是否影响学习深度?
A: 不影响核心逻辑学习,但可能限制对底层原理的理解,建议初学者用手机入门,待掌握基础后,再迁移至PC端深入学习操作系统、内存管理等高阶知识。
Q3: 2026年手机端开发App的费用是多少?
A: 基础开发工具大多免费,若使用云端IDE的高级功能(如更大内存、私有仓库),月费通常在$10-$20之间,上架应用商店需支付开发者账号费,iOS为$99/年,Android为$25一次性费用。
互动引导
你目前最想用App开发解决什么实际问题?欢迎在评论区分享你的创意,我们将为你推荐最适合的工具链。
参考文献
-
机构/作者:Apple Inc. / 苹果开发者关系团队
时间:2026年1月
名称:《Swift Playgrounds 4.0 开发者指南:从iPad到App Store的完整路径》
摘要:详细阐述了移动端原生开发的最新标准与审核规范。 -
机构/作者:Gartner Research
时间:2025年12月
名称:《2026年移动开发趋势报告:云端IDE的崛起与边缘计算》
摘要:分析了云端开发环境在降低硬件门槛方面的市场渗透率数据。
-
机构/作者:Google Developers
时间:2026年2月
名称:《Android 15 开发者最佳实践:移动端调试与性能优化》
摘要:提供了针对移动端开发环境的官方调试工具链更新说明。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/514261.html


评论列表(3条)
这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于机构的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!
@美暖3696:这篇文章写得非常好,内容丰富,观点清晰,让我受益匪浅。特别是关于机构的部分,分析得很到位,给了我很多新的启发和思考。感谢作者的精心创作和分享,期待看到更多这样高质量的内容!
读了这篇文章,我深有感触。作者对机构的理解非常深刻,论述也很有逻辑性。内容既有理论深度,又有实践指导意义,确实是一篇值得细细品味的好文章。希望作者能继续创作更多优秀的作品!